Özet (EN)

In this thesis it is aimed to investigate limitations and the existed possibilities which facilitate and supply for the visualization of 3D cadastre. For this purpose; it has been conducted firstly the analysis of the studies which is about this topic in the World. For this analysis, it has been examined the literature created within the group and the survey carried out by the International Federation of Surveyors (FIG) 3D Cadastre working group in 2010, 2014 and 2018. In addition to the studies in the world, it has been determined that studies are being planned for 3D visualization of the cadastral in Turkey. In February of 2018, the General Directorate of Land Registry and Cadastre (TKGM) announced a project entitled "3D urban models and Cadastre project".. In December 2018, TKGM went out to tender for the first package of its project titled "production of 3D city models and creation of 3D Cadastre bases". According to the detailed project and tender documents examined in detail at the dissertation study, it has been determined that the first packages contracted out of this project, which are planned to take 4 Years, cover a total of 14466 sheets of 1/1000 scale and 32762 architectural projects. Within the scope of the thesis study, the usability of different spatial data models for 3D visualization of cadastral survey has been investigated. As a result of examples of overseas and the study of the 3D cadastre project of TKGM in Turkey, the data models that can be used for cadastre have been determined as CityGML, IFC, IndoorGML, LandXML and LADM. Finally; within the scope of the thesis the sample applications was carried out. Thus, different models of 3D modeling and representation alternatives have been introduced considering the different approaches of the countries ,the projects planned in Turkey and the spatial data models studied. CAD-based, CityGML-based and web-based approaches stand out for their usability in modeling buildings and 'individual unit'. In addition; at the 3D visualization of the cadastral data, which is the main purpose of the thesis, by using 3D PDF, Nasa World Wind, Cesium, Terra Explorer, Google Earth the generated 3D models are presented as 3D using Google Earth. Mapping General Directorate (HGM) brought into use HGM-Atlas and HGM-Küre applications on 24 January 2019. Thereupon; the presentation of the 3D models produced with the national application of HGM- Küre has been also taken into consideration in the thesis study and the integration of the Model models with the HGM- Küre has been ensured. Due to the fact that 3D models produced can be presented with domestic and national infrastructure, it will be possible not to pay fees paid abroad for similar applications and to prevent the collection of personal data through similar foreign applications.
